  • Forget the Gay stuff

    It seems that most teams are ramping up their pursuit of Gay, but the Raptors are reportedly bowing out due to his prohibitive cost.

    Doug Smith of The Toronto Star wrote on Monday:

    According to a highly-placed source, any chance of the Raptors picking up Rudy Gay in a trade are diminishing rapidly and it’s less and less likely something will happen.

    The reason?

    The asking price is far too high.

    Smith found that the Griz are interested in Jose Calderon’s expiring contract, Terrence Ross and one of the plethora of young big men on the Toronto roster.

    While Gay is certainly a great player, he’s not a franchise piece that would suddenly make the Raptors title contenders. For this reason alone, he’s not worth giving up an arm and a leg via trade.

    It’ll be interesting to see if Memphis’ price comes down or goes up with the deadline looming closer.
